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
685950877 50738 3196174
7436463152 413
7436463152 413
30743 114787 751592
All about undefined
Interested in learning more?
7436463152 413
30743 114787 751592
See more
38 632
57 77 441 6713300849 36218
See more
32267347 87340082705
7253806125 29 153530655
See more